Population | 926,426 | 110,000 | 2,900,000 | 15,520,000 | 731,387 | 880,691 | 1,270,169 | 1,108,700 |
Official language(s) | English (de facto) | English, Bajan Creole | Spanish | Turkish | Ukrainian | Spanish | Bulgarian | Georgian |
Level of English | Very high | Very high | High | Low | Low | Low | High | Low |
Main airport |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) | Bridgetown/Grantley Adams International Airport (BGI) | Ministro Pistarini International Airport (EZE) | Istanbul Airport (IST) | Lviv Danylo Halytskyi International Airport (LWO) | Tocumen International Airport (PTY) | Sofia International Airport (SOF) | Tbilisi International Airport (TBS) |
Most common months to visit | March - May, September - November | November - May | September - December | April - June, September and October | May - September | December - April | April-June, September-October | March - June |
Currency | USD - US Dollar ($) | BBD - Barbadian dollar ($) | ARS - Argentine Peso ($) | TRY - Turkish Lira (₺) | UAH - Ukrainian Hryvnia (₴) | PAB - Panamanian Balboa (B/.) | BGN - Bulgarian Lev (лв) | GEL - Georgian Lari (₾) |
Credit cards | Accepted almost everywhere | Accepted in some places, cash also needed for smaller businesses | Accepted everywhere. (ID required!) | Accepted in most places | Accepted almost everywhere | Accepted almost everywhere but not in smaller shops. | Accepted everywhere | Accepted everywhere |
Remote worker visa | No | Yes | No | No | No | Yes | No | Yes |
Average monthly costs | $3484 | $2702 | $1321 | $659 | $922 | $2359 | $1289 | $1462 |
Rent | $1650 | $1054 | $844 | $354 | $400 | $1036 | $567 | $752 |
Groceries | $243 | $234 | $98 | $44 | $91 | $236 | $10 | $112 |
Dining out | $396 | $345 | $121 | $81 | $151 | $371 | $227 | $169 |
Cafe | $66 | $75 | $25 | $18 | $21 | $43 | $27 | $45 |
Coworking space | $331 | $321 | $95 | $49 | $79 | $157 | $140 | $125 |
Mobile internet | $40 | $49 | $11 | $3 | $4 | $21 | $10 | $4 |
Public transportation | $110 | $35 | $9 | $6 | $5 | $12 | $30 | $8 |
Taxis | $73 | $106 | $9 | $6 | $12 | $48 | $12 | $14 |
Shared bicycles and scooters | $96 | $0 | $14 | $2 | $16 | $0 | $40 | $27 |
Sport and cultural events | $54 | $37 | $24 | $11 | $13 | $35 | $18 | $21 |
Museums and sights | $11 | $36 | $4 | $15 | $9 | $9 | $12 | $9 |
Nightlife | $124 | $96 | $23 | $22 | $43 | $117 | $82 | $53 |
Gym | $62 | $86 | $14 | $9 | $22 | $37 | $23 | $33 |
Yoga | $139 | $130 | $19 | $23 | $30 | $163 | $62 | $37 |
Massage | $89 | $99 | $10 | $15 | $27 | $75 | $29 | $53 |
SIM card options | AT&T, T-Mobile. | Digicel | Movistar, Claro, Personal | Turkcell, Turk Telekom | Vodafone, Kyivstar | Claro, Movistar | A1, Telenor, Vivacom | Magti GSM, Geocell, Beeline |
Tipping | 15-20% at restaurants, 1USD or more per drink at cafes and bars | 10 - 15% usually included in restaurants, add 10 - 15% at bars | 10% at restaurants and cafés is common, not common at bars | Tip 5-10% in restaurants, cafés and bars | 10% in restaurants, not expected elsewhere | 10% in restaurants, round up elsewhere | 10% in restaurants, 1-2 BGN at bars and cafés | 10% usually included in bill, not expected at bars or cafés. |
Taxi apps | Uber, Lyft | None available | Uber (not official), Cabify, BA Taxi (Spanish only) | BiTaksi | Uber, Uklon | Uber, Tu Chofer | TaxiMe, TaxiStars | Yandex, Bolt |
Tap water | Drinkable | Not drinkable | Not drinkable | Not drinkable | Not drinkable | Not drinkable | Not drinkable | Not drinkable |
